To prioritize self-care and prevent burnout, it’s important to set clear boundaries and take regular breaks. Schedule your working hours and stick to them to avoid overworking. Incorporate physical exercise, sufficient sleep, and healthy eating into your daily routine. Use relaxation techniques like meditation or breathing exercises to reduce stress. It’s also crucial to make time for hobbies and social interactions to clear your mind.

It's important to keep productivity levels high, especially when you're in the midst of something as crucial as technical analysis, which prepares your company for the next financial year. Here are my personal tricks for maintaining high productivity:
- Regular Breaks: Incorporate short breaks during working hours. For example, you could use the Pomodoro Technique: 25 minutes of focused work followed by a 5-minute break. This approach promotes a healthy #mind.
- Regular Exercise: Aim to exercise every odd morning for 15-20 minutes. You could go for a run, jump rope, or even just do some jumping exercises. This keeps the body healthy.
- Yoga: Practice yoga regularly to foster a #healthy spirit.

When deep into technical analysis, balancing work and self-care is crucial. For instance, during a hectic trading week in 2021, I started taking 5-minute breaks every hour to step away from my charts. This helped me reset and stay sharp. I also established a firm end to my workday at 5 PM, ensuring time for hobbies and relaxation. Adding short mindfulness exercises, like 15-minute meditation sessions, also kept stress in check. These simple practices helped me stay focused without burning out, ensuring long-term productivity and well-being.

To prioritize self-care while immersed in technical analysis, I set strict work boundaries, ensuring breaks every few hours to clear my mind. I practice the Pomodoro technique to maintain focus without overexertion. Regular exercise, meditation, and proper sleep help recharge mentally and physically. Staying connected with friends and pursuing hobbies outside work creates balance. Lastly, I avoid overworking by setting daily goals, using automation tools for analysis, and keeping weekends free to prevent burnout.
